1. 业奇网 > 经验交流 >

学习Spring中JdbcTemplate操作技巧

在学习Spring框架的过程中,使用JdbcTemplate是进行数据库操作的常见方法之一。通过JdbcTemplate,我们可以方便地进行数据库查询、插入、更新和删除等操作。下面将介绍如何在Spring中使用JdbcTemplate来对数据库进行数据的查询。

学习Spring中JdbcTemplate操作技巧

查询单条记录

首先,让我们看一下如何使用JdbcTemplate来获取数据库表中的一条记录,并将该记录转换成一个实例对象进行输出。在MySQL数据库中,我们以employees表为例,以下是代码示例:

```java

Employee employee jdbcTemplate.queryForObject("SELECT * FROM employees WHERE id ?", new Object[]{id}, new EmployeeRowMapper());

(());

```

通过运行以上代码,我们可以在控制台中查看查询到的实体对象,确保与数据库中的数据一致。

查询多条记录

接着,我们来看一下如何使用JdbcTemplate来获取数据库表中的多条记录,并将这些记录转换成多个实例对象进行输出。同样以employees表为例,以下是代码示例:

```java

List employees jdbcTemplate.query("SELECT * FROM employees", new EmployeeRowMapper());

for(Employee emp : employees) {

(());

}

```

通过运行以上代码,我们可以在控制台中查看查询到的多个实体对象,验证查询多条记录的操作是否成功。

查询单个值

除了查询记录外,有时候我们可能只需要获取数据库表中的某个单值。使用JdbcTemplate也可以轻松实现这一功能。以下是查询单值的示例代码:

```java

int count jdbcTemplate.queryForObject("SELECT COUNT(*) FROM employees", );

("Total number of employees: " count);

```

通过运行以上代码,我们可以在控制台中查看查询到的单值,并确认查询单值的操作成功完成。

通过以上介绍,我们学习了在Spring中使用JdbcTemplate进行数据库操作的基本技巧,包括查询单条记录、查询多条记录和查询单个值。掌握这些技巧,能够帮助我们更高效地进行数据库操作,提升开发效率。如果想要深入学习Spring中JdbcTemplate的更多功能和用法,还需要进一步实践和探索。愿你在学习过程中收获满满!

本文由用户上传,如有侵权请联系删除!